Does Chick-fil-A Canada Serve Halal Chicken?
Currently, Chick-fil-A in Canada does not advertise or certify its chicken as halal. The brand uses high-quality, fresh chicken for all menu items, but it is not sourced or prepared under halal certification in Canadian locations.
This means Muslim customers who strictly follow halal guidelines may not be able to eat Chick-fil-A’s main chicken entrees such as the Original Chicken Sandwich, Nuggets, or Chick-n-Strips.

Why Chick-fil-A is Not Halal in Canada (Yet)
The main reason Chick-fil-A is not halal-certified in Canada is due to supply chain sourcing and preparation standards. Halal certification requires strict guidelines for how meat is sourced, processed, and cooked. Since Chick-fil-A’s supply system in North America is standardized, switching to halal-certified chicken in Canada alone would require major adjustments.
However, as demand for halal fast food grows in Canada—especially in cities like Toronto, Calgary, and Vancouver—it is possible that Chick-fil-A may consider halal options in the future. Other chains like Popeyes and KFC have already introduced halal-certified locations in certain Canadian cities.
